Duke Capital Limited

 

("Duke Capital", "Duke" or the "Company")

 

Trading and Operational Update

 

Duke Capital Limited (AIM: DUKE), a leading provider of hybrid capital solutions for SME business owners in Europe and North America, is pleased to provide guidance on its trading for the fourth quarter of the financial year ending 31 March 2026 ("Q4 FY26").

 

Trading Update

 

Duke expects to achieve record recurring cash revenue* of £7.0 million in Q4 FY26. This represents an 8% year-on-year increase on Q4 FY25 (£6.5 million) and an increase of £0.2 million over the prior quarter, which saw the Company deliver recurring cash revenue of £6.8 million.

 

Total cash revenue for Q4 FY26 is expected to total £8.5 million following receipt of the final tranche of deferred consideration from the Fabrikat exit in February 2024.

* Recurring cash revenue excludes exit premium receipts and cash gains from equity sales

** Total cash revenue is monthly cash distributions from Duke's partners plus exit premium receipts and cash gains from equity sales

 

Fabrikat exit

 

· Duke invested £6.2 million into Fabrikat in February 2021 and received £3.2 million in distributions until the sale of the company in March 2024 to Metalogalva - Irmãos Silvas, SA, a Portuguese company in the area of engineering and steel protection.

· Upon sale, Duke received total proceeds of £11.4 million, including £1.5 million in deferred payments, which resulted in a 35% IRR over a five-year period.

About Duke Capital

 

Duke is a leading provider of hybrid capital solutions for SME business owners in Europe and North America, combining the best features of both equity and debt.

 

Since 2017, Duke has provided unique long-term financing which eliminates re-financing risk and necessity for a short-term exit by providing a unique 'corporate mortgage' while also aligning its returns to grow with the success of the business.

 

Duke is focused on generating attractive risk-adjusted returns for shareholders and has a track record of achieving this across market cycles. Its three investment pillars are capital preservation, attractive dividend yield, and to provide upside upon exits.

 

Duke is listed on the AIM market under the ticker DUKE and is headquartered in Guernsey.
